Just like the first book in The Empire of the Wolf trilogy, I greatly enjoyed the world-building, the religious aspects, the political maneuvering, the ‘horror’ elements, the detective/mystery aspects, and the character development of The Tyranny of Faith. I have enjoyed Richard Swan’s prose and his storytelling. He has a talent for weaving together so many different ideas into a comprehensive whole. This is a fascinating story with some wonderful twists and turns and I look forward to finishing the series very soon.
